Key Concept
Anti-Semitic Legislation in Nazi Germany
Explanation
The Decree on the Elimination of Jews from Economic Life was issued on November 12, 1938, as part of the broader anti-Semitic policies of Nazi Germany. This decree effectively barred Jewish people from participating in the German economy by prohibiting them from operating businesses and participating in agricultural activities, which included membership in cooperative societies. This was one of many legal restrictions placed on Jews as the Nazi regime sought to isolate and disenfranchise the Jewish population in Germany.
